Cutbacks to the elderly

Having attended a chairobics session this morning with my elderly mum, I learned the Sheffield council are making extensive cuts to Activity Sheffield, resulting in redundancy for ours and many other exercise instructors.

The session today was attended by 21 people doing chairobics and table tennis.

How sad that this important connection for people aged 60 to 90 may lose the opportunity to stay healthy physically and emotionally.
